I have designed a logo for my business website. but when i upload to the site. It changes the color. Why Is that and what should i do.

Almost all web browsers use colour management nowadays, this means that they read the embedded image ICC profile and convert that data to the display screen's ICC colourspace.

So an embedded ICC profile is needed in images to facilitate that. 

That’s a setting in Photoshop

 

Perhaps work in sRGB [save with sRGB embedded] since, IF such an image is viewed without colour management it is the image colour space most likely to provide reasonable accuracy of appearance. 

Check the browser you're using with this test: 

https://cameratico.com/tools/web-browser-color-management-test/

 

You'll need to be sure that the server isn't stripping the ICC profiles from uploaded images.
